Job Description:

The Proposal Coordinator supports the Business Development (BD) Services team with the development of qualifications materials, including proposals, SOQs, presentations and other materials necessary to secure new client and project opportunities. This position reports to the BD Services Manager and works closely with key members of each business unit and the Creative Services Team.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Collect, organize, and develop proposal content, including layout, resumes, and project profiles.
  • Coordinate the proposal process with key team members, focusing on administrative and logistical aspects.
  • Support the proposal lifecycle, including planning, content development, and submission.
  • Lead subconsultant proposal requests and ensure compliance with best practices.
  • Serve as the primary contact for clients during the proposal process.
  • Proofread proposals and marketing documents.
  • Work within Creative Services templates and frameworks.
  • Manage resource allocation to meet deadlines.
  • Develop and maintain boilerplate materials, project lists, resumes, and project profiles.
  • Support development and editing of presentations for shortlist interviews.
  • Maintain business development information in Deltek Vantagepoint.
  • Collaborate with business unit members on business development, proposal strategy, and client management.
  • Ensure alignment with brand standards and firm-wide messaging themes.
  • Support other business development tasks as needed.

Required Skills/Experience:

  • Effective teamwork skills.
  • Strong written and verbal communication.
  • Excellent organizational skills for managing timelines, resources, and tasks.
  • Ability to lead and coordinate cross-functional teams.
  • Capability to analyze solicitation documents and RFPs.
  • Proficiency in Adobe InDesign/Creative Suite and MS Office.
  • Strong database management skills.
  • Willingness to work extra hours to meet deadlines and travel for meetings.

Preferred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in liberal arts, communications, or marketing.
  • 3+ years of experience in proposal development, preferably in the AEC industry.
  • Deltek Vantagepoint experience.
